Default 300 Rum feeding problem

ok so I have hunted with my new Savage 300 rum for 6 days and after loading/unloading it 6 times (blind mag) I have noticed that I have feeding problems. The problem is with the second shot, If I cycle the bolt and eject the first shot, the second will not feed into the chamber unless I take my palm and slam the bolt forward. I took it to my gunsmith today and he said because of the long case that the casing is getting hung up on the top curved part of the mag (the part that actually holds the shell down in the mag) Its only the second shot, in a staggered mag its the only one that sits on the "left" looking down at it. He said that brownells makes a mag conversion for guns that makes all 3 shots center feed, but of course not for a 300 rum. Hes going to try to clean the edge of my mag up with a stone to get it to feed better, but does anyone have this problem, or suggestions as to how to fix it? With the way my gun is acting a second shot is nearly impossible.

*side note I used factory and handloads just to make sure it wasnt something in my resizing process.
